Tabular Data - 1.8 KB - 4 Variables, 79 Observations - UNF:6:aIyuHfDcWPT9LJvtkCge9w==
Data generated by running test/performance.cpp (but here in tab-separated instead of csv format). The columns, as can be seen in test/performance.cpp, are: Dimension of the grid, bound for the level sum, number of points in the grid, median runtime in seconds. |

Mar 14, 2022 - Publication: Effects of Thermal Treatment on Acoustic Waves in Carrara Marble
Ruf, Matthias; Steeb, Holger, 2021, "Effects of thermal treatment on acoustic waves in Carrara marble: measurement data", https://doi.org/10.18419/DARUS-1862, DaRUS, V2, UNF:6:yNzdCgAqR5WmMI9AAE0olA== [fileUNF]
This Dataset contains the measurement data of the related publication Ruf & Steeb (2022). In this, twelve thermal treatments, differing in the applied maximum temperature and the applied cooling condition (slow versus fast cooling) are experimentally studied for dry Bianco Carrara marble under ambient conditions.
